If you withdraw money from an HSA to pay the medical bills of an ex-spouse, you will owe income tax on the money, and a 20% penalty if the HSA owner is younger than 65. ... Understand the rules and regulations that come with having an HSA as there are limits to how much you can ...Money moved as part of an IRA-to-HSA rollover counts toward the IRS's annual HSA contribution limit. That means in 2023, you can roll over $3,850 if you have coverage just for yourself and $7,750 if you have family coverage. This rises to $4,150 for self-only coverage and $8,300 for family coverage in 2024. Those 55 and older can …Limitations on Withdrawals. UMB limits certain types of withdrawals (including transfers) from savings and money market accounts. You may make no more than six (6) withdrawals and transfers from your UMB Savings account to another of your accounts or to third parties during a monthly service charge cycle.

For 2024, the IRS defines a high deductible health plan as any plan with a deductible of at least $1,600 for an individual or $3,200 for a family.Nov 6, 2016 · Option 1: Remove in the Current Year. This is probably the preferred option. If you catch your mistake before you file your taxes, you can avoid all penalties by removing the excess contributions (and any of their earnings) from your HSA and treating them as normal taxable income. Other non-traditional ways of getting funds into your account include: An IRA to HSA transfer - this can be done once in a lifetime and counts against your annual contribution limit. You also have to be eligible to make contributions into an HSA account in the year that you do this.
